When 9d9b6d8 changed our target SDK version to Android 16, it made
Android 16 stop calling onBackPressed and stop delivering KEYCODE_BACK
events. Dolphin's code isn't ready for that yet.
Android lets us opt out of this new behavior for now, so let's do so.
But the opt-out will presumably stop working once we start targeting
Android 17, so we're going to have to update Dolphin's code within the
next one or two years to support the replacement API.
We can register a BroadcastReceiver to have Android tell us when a GC
adapter gets connected instead of having a loop where we continuously
call SleepCurrentThread(1000) and poll the current status. When waiting
for a GC adapter to connect, this both reduces power usage and improves
responsiveness.
Note that I made openAdapter get the UsbDevice that's been stored by the
hotplug code instead of having openAdapter find the UsbDevice on its own
like before. This is only because I want to ensure that the UsbDevice
being tracked for disconnection is the same as the UsbDevice actually
being used, in case the user has multiple adapters connected.
When Android sends Dolphin to the background, emulation *must* pause,
otherwise emulation continues running and continues outputting audio to
the user. RetroAchievements mustn't be allowed to override it.
Without this, there was a bug where if you turned the device's screen
off and on again while in the advanced mapping dialog, the input
indicators would stop updating. This is because turning the screen on
again causes devices to refresh, which causes all devices to be
recreated, leaving the AdvancedMappingControlViewHolders stuck
referencing controls belonging to devices that are no longer being
updated.
This makes sure view holders get proper widths when they use
layout_width="match_parent". This becomes quite noticeable for
AdvancedMappingControlAdapter in the next commit, but I'm also
making the change for other adapters while I'm at it.
